About This Item
London: George Allen & Unwin, 1973. Cloth. Collectible; Fine/Fine. A very solid copy of the 1973 1st UK edition. Tight and Near Fine in a bright, price-intact, Near Fine dustjacket. Octavo, 249 pgs. "Translated and edited, with a biographical sketch and bibliography, by Hubert C. Kennedy"
